Definition

  1. 1
    Nominativ Singular Maskulinum der starken Flexion des Positivs des Adjektivs brasilianisch
  2. 2
    Genitiv Singular Femininum der starken Flexion des Positivs des Adjektivs brasilianisch
  3. 3
    Dativ Singular Femininum der starken Flexion des Positivs des Adjektivs brasilianisch
  4. 4
    Genitiv Plural alle Genera der starken Flexion des Positivs des Adjektivs brasilianisch
  5. 5
    Nominativ Singular Maskulinum der gemischten Flexion des Positivs des Adjektivs brasilianisch
